Steven Gerrard issues Liverpool FC derby match rallying cry

27 November 2009 08:00
STEVEN GERRARD today issued a pre-derby rallying cry and insisted Liverpool's squad will stay united to turn their season around.[LNB]Few people have felt the frustration of the Reds early exit from the Champions League more than Gerrard, who is acutely aware certain critics perceive them as a club in crisis.[LNB]The captain, however, has made it emphatically clear nothing could be further from the truth and says the group Rafa Benitez will take to Goodison Park on Sunday are all pulling in the same direction.[LNB]What's more, Gerrard believes the experiences of the last two months have only served to make Liverpool stronger and he is hoping there will be an emphatic response to recent disappointments when they tackle Everton.[LNB]'We're all aware the season isn't going the way we would want it to and we're really disappointed to have gone out of the Champions League,' said Gerrard.[LNB]'We're far from happy with our form in the Premier League as well but the only way to turn things around is by sticking together.[LNB]'We've shown in the past what we can achieve when we do that and if there's one positive about the difficult time we've been having, it's that we've all pulled together.[LNB]'The manager, the staff and the players are all working as hard as we can to try and get the improvement we've been looking for.
